| Family | Cactaceae |
| Identification | Opuntia ficus-indica (L.)Mill. |
| Determined by | J. Madsen, 1986 |
| Identification qualifier | |
| Field notes | Up to 2 m high. Joints oblong-ovate, to 35 cm long. Spines 1-2, about 1 cm long, white, with darker tips, caducous. Flower 8-9 cm long, orange. Tepals 3 cm long. Ovule-chamber 2 cm long. Style about 3 cm long, white. Stigmas 7, pale yellow. Filaments yellow, reddish basically. Anthers yellow. |
